Node.js + php + angular fullstack developer ложится спать пока работнички пиздуют на работенку.
Задавайте свои ответы про веб разработку. На джумле, вордпресс и прочем не работаю. Отбитые дауны, которые считают, что веб - это лэндинги и интернет магазины идут нахуй
>>167595023 С ангуляра начал так и пошел. В реакт выкатываться надо, а у меня по плану монго изучить как следует, поэтому представлению пока немного уделяю времени. Одни сборщики проектов чего стоят. Ноду второй раз осваиваю. Второе впечатление очень хорошее, больше нет сомнений, что это будущее. Экспресс, да. Рамда - первый раз слышу.
>>167595052 Представление данных через браузер пользователю. Для кого-то это панели управления, инструменты бизнес аналитики и так далее. В том числе мобильные приложения.
>>167595152 Ну ты короче это. Быстро решительно берёшь create-react-app и тебя окружение настраивается. Сборщики хуёрщики. Только бери flow. TS дно, хотя началось заебись. Нода - будующее? Ну хз. как по мне так только для SSR юзать. Нормальную производительность выжимать заебёшься. Акторы появились только недавно и тож так себе.
>>167595197 От четырех. >>167595179 Gulp. Если пишешь код одного функционала в отдельный файл, то надо все сконкатинировать и изуродовать. Плюс стили и картинки обработать. >>167595221 Тс для больших проектов. Пока сам не использую т.к. один разработчик в проекте как обычно. Производительность достигается за счёт архитектуры, а не технологий, как я понял, хотя момент спорный.
>>167595260 codecademy.com/learn предлагают платную хуиту, но она тебе не нужна, бесплатного материала более чем достаточно, если ты конечно не конченый еблан
>>167595382 Какая у тебя архитектура, ты о чём. Нода однопоточная. Чтобы разбить её нужно норм поплясать с бубном или акторами. Хоть ты славь омниссию один хер упрёшься в боттлнек. ТС для средних проектов тож хорошо заходит да и мелкие тож нарм. Автодокументирование, тесты, вот это всё. Просто чтобы писать на ноде хороший производительный код надо ПОПОТЕТЬ неслабо так. А как SSR провайдер прям заебись.
>>167595425 Хуита эта академия. Прошел там html, css, js - тут же все выветривается из головы. В python решил вкатываться основательно - через Марка Лутца. И таки вкатился. Уже пишу скрипты, помогающие в работе.
>>167595519 ага, видимо я в другой реальности живу, где каждую неделю всплывают новости, что индустрии катастрофически не хватает специалистов и что рынок растёт быстрее, чем люди успевают учиться.
>>167595453 Потому что его диктует сообщество, которое так хочет. Я считаю что основной минут этого языка это отсутствие хороших и быстрых инструментов отладки. Так как пыха мой первый язык, то он мне нравится.
>>167595518 Зарабатываю 100к в месяц, не выходя из дома. Мне нужен только интернет. Из знаний - html+css (bootstrap), wordpress, базовые знания php и jquery. Задавай свои АХАХАХА
>>167595571 А я и не говорил что С ТАКИМИ знаниями тяжело заработать. Проорал с школьных преувеличений про ТАКИЕ знания. Прям бакалавр веба блядь. Пару месяцев дрочки и уже ТАКИЕ знания, сам Хокинг уткнулся
>>167595551 Не хватает специалистов нормальных с кучей бэкграунда, знаний и прочего. Потому, что таких специалистов реально не хватает, но масштабы отрасли ML и например web просто несопоставимы.
>>167595690 веб скукоживается благодаря мл. тот же фронтенд в плане графики через год-два будут делать нейросети. только картинку нарисовал, а вся разметка автоматически. ну и так далее.
>>167595725 А ты специалист, как я погляжу. Вёрстка и фронт это разное. Расскажи как и на каком базисе ML сейчас построит дуплексное реактивное приложение например?
>>167595770 >фронт фронт в конечном итоге это джаваскрипт. хоть ты на брейнфаке пиши с миллионом фреймворков, всё это перехуячивается в джаваскрипт, потому что браузеры из коробки больше нихуя не поддерживают.
>>167595843 Не, я диванона боюсь. Скажу что там простенькая редактируемая йоба на Vue которая еще и сохраняет состояние сессии. Задачка буквально на часа 4 для новичка типа меня
>>167595938 Рендеринг на сервере. Клиенту прилетает готовая аппа с уже готовым стейтом. В целом сильно быстрее доставляется доставляется контент до пользака. Т.к. все мы щас живём в SPA в основном, то самый проблемный момент как раз инициализация и первичная загрузка. Через SSR это решается оч классно.
>>167596262 Да не парься. Это нужно не так часто. В основном всякие топовые канторы используют, где важна скорость доставки. Ну и ещё SEO туда вкручивается лучше чем в классический SPA
>>167596038 Выкатиться - надо начать. Будешь ахуевать, а потом затянет и будешь ахуевать до конца жизни. А ещё будет азарт и бездонный мир технологий только в одной ветке.
>>167596354 Спасибо за инфу. Я вообще максималист и всегда изучаю такое в ущерб текущему мейнстриму, как со спа в свое время. Я думаю что ssr будет важной технологией через годик или два.
>>167596479 Спорно. Много нюансов и заморочек. Это нужно только когда нужно. Ты же не тянешь везде Immutable rxjs и прочее. Инструмент нужен к месту. Но вообще разобраться стоит. Благо сейчас с этим попроще стало.
>>167596617 Нет. Пхп трогал пару раз в жизни и то, чтобы прикрутить внешний сервис помогал инженерам из другой канторы. Прекрасно живу без него. Что вообще за пиздецовая идея реинициализировать приложение каждый запуск.
>>167596662 Так и скажи что язык даже не нюхал, а поливаешь грязью патамушта типа модно. Пыха давно уже не поднимается на каждый чих, а тихо крутится на своём порту.
>>167594898 (OP) >fullstack developer ложится спать пока работнички пиздуют на работенку Отвечай на вопрос >>167595934 Иначе ты не фрилансобог а диванный школьник ёпта.
>>167596800 Вообще почитываю в целом за направление. Чтобы пыха крутилась на своём порту демоном нужно пару раз присесть и новичку который только вкатывается это хз зачем надо. ООП слизанный с Java это конечно норм, но новичку тож хз зачем это если он не собирается вкатывается в PHP по серьёзке. Вообще я не хейчу пыху просто категорически не нравится.
>>167596868 Ну скажем так. Проблем с поиском работы нет. Есть проблемы с тем чем будет интересно заниматься. Вообще в данный момент порезал свой профиль на hh, т.к. устраивает то чем занимаюсь.
>>167596859 Чё сложного-то? В базе хранишь куку, если в апи пришла такая кука, то проверяешь роль и доступ. По кнопке удоляешь куку из базы и на следующий запрос в апи с ней отвечаешь 401. Простата же.
>>167596995 У меня в месяц выходит 60 сейчас, максимум сотка. Не хочу на работы устраиваться, хочу дома учиться, хотя без команды всё в разы медленнее. Думаю какой-нибудь актив создать
>>167596943 Он по умолчанию так работает, php-fpm. Но концепция осталась старой, у каждой сессии своё окружение и с другими она не взаимодействует. Php сообщество активно пиздит фишки других языков, что не может не радовать.
>>167597037 Я не совсем вопрос понимаю. Jwt - это и так на лету в моем понимании. У тебя вопрос без контекста, мне нечего предложить или выдумывать прям сейчас универсальную реализацию лень
>>167597139 Если ты параноик и хочешь проверять каждый раз то kv хранилище какое-то. От inmem до редиса с аэроспайком. Но довольно часто можно проверять время с последнего запроса + хост + валидность jwt. Если постоянно с одного адреса после авторизации (с использованием бд) у тебя летят запросы то это тот же пользак. Если ойпе поменялся то уже можно от обстоятельств плясать.
>>167597037 >а как jwt разлогинивать Не лезь туда. Это основной подводный камень jwt, поддержка которого стоит дороже всех олдскульных способов авторизации. Вкрации, должна быть вторая кука, которая обозначает валидность токена.
>>167597260 Ну это не корректный вопрос. Коммерческая разработка в ООО Василёк и ядро React например. И с другой стороны опенсурс проект васяна и Netflix.
>>167597207 >Jwt - это и так на лету в моем понимании В каком смысле на лету? На каждый запрос новый токен генерить чтоли? Суть в том, что юзер логинится, ему дается jwt токен в котором ему доступные scope'ы или объекты. Роли пользователя обновили, что дальше-то делать? >>167597305 Ну а как тогда авторизовать на всем доступном открытом апи?
>>167597373 >Ну а как тогда авторизовать на всем доступном открытом апи? Авторизовать через jwt. Но если задача подразумевает возможность отзыва токена, то лучше выбрать не jwt.
>>167597509 >то лучше выбрать не jwt Просто не вижу принципиальной разницы, получается в любом случае дергать бд придется на проверку валидности токена, тогда jwt или не jwt разницы нет.
>>167597636 Я не первый год читаю доки на английском. Этот язык родным не становится и не все понятно. Короче да, лучше инглиш получить, но немало ему первое место уделять
>>167597782 >SI Писал тебе на почту с год назад, так я и не смог вкатиться в программирование за год, уж больно тяжёлый выдался. Но мой проект всё ещё ждет своего часа. Накати там ещё бокальчик темпранильо за меня.
>>167597883 если ты из любого города миллионника то сходи и купи, вроде вино не запрещали к ввозу в РФ? Не обязательно дорогое, кстати греческие вина достаточно норм.
люблю риоху темпранильо, особенно ховен
>>167597936 жалко анончик, вкатывайся если можешь, особенно если у тебя есть идеи на реализацию.
>>167598129 >жалко анончик, вкатывайся если можешь, особенно если у тебя есть идеи на реализацию А мне то как жалко, но я твердо намерен проект доделать. Потом отпишусь когда закончу. Добра тебе.
SSR костыли для SEO. Писать для браузера чтобы потом рендерить на сервере могут только совсем отбитые хайпать. Главное делают это с таким лицом будто все так и должно быть, только выиграли. Ангулар девы совсем ебанулись, как после первого они сломали обратную совместимость так я на это говно без смеха смотреть не могу. Писать на нем SPA чтобы потом через год снова переписывать. А что, красиво, модно, молодежно. Дебилы блядь. Про сборщики та же хуйня - gulp, grunt, webpack ... что там будет модно в следующем году? Я пользуюсь make и мне хватает - scss в css перегнать. Нахуя все паковть? Все равно HTTP2 все нормально раздавать будет. Картинки переживать? Ну пережили сам, они у тебя что каждый раз разные после сборки? Автопрефиксер? Нахуй это говно, используй то что есть и стабильно. Что еще забыл? Реакт. Ну посмотрим как ты закукарекаешь когда очередной роутер от васяна не будет работать с твоим говнокодом и скажет что не поддерживает твою версию, потому что реакт это не фреймворк и у него нет тулзов из коробки и надо все самому прикручивать. Да и твой реакт закончиться когда фб он перестанет быть нужен. И кто тогда твой говнокод суппортить будет? Вуе - еще один шедевр, который одним васяном поддерживается. Конечно у них есть кокомьюнити, но ты даже не заметишь как они быстро разбегутся когда васяну надоест.
>>167596251 >когда компуктер научится писать код не в этом столетии чувак, нейронки это узкоспециализированная хуйня, чтобы там не орали, она может помочь тебе писать более правильный код, но писать за тебя она никогда не сможет, нейронки не имеют фантазии
В добавок про "нейронки" в программировании Если всё такие кто-то создаст что-то что будет писать код Так всеж кодеры легко переквалифицируются в тех кто будет эти нейронки настраивать и впаривать лохам, так же как сейчас сайты)
>>167598700 Нейронные сети это не искусственный интеллект. Это тупо блоб данных - весов и прочей хуйни, который ты получаешь после обучения. И обучение ты делаешь на фичах, которые ты еще экстрактить должен перед обучением. Нейроны - это очень грубо куча иф-ов которую ты вручную писать заебешься и которые в слои собраны. Никакой магии и никакого интеллекта.
Поясните чухану на php во что модно сейчас вкатываться в плане веба? За что нынче бабки то платят? На что спрос? Больше 70к не могу выжать, а хочется писать меньше а получать больше
>>167599014 >opencart Вот в этом у меня и проблема. Поддерживаю в основном всякие опенсорсы на пхп, но как правило те, кто выбрал опенсорс в качестве основы и бабки не готов особые платить. Хочется вкатиться в стек технологий, чтобы помоднее, пилить сайты с нуля, хайлоад мож какой нить?
>>167595260 Завтра ищешь в интернете книжку Dive into python. Похуй если ничего не поймешь. Затем идешь на python.org и изучаешь стандартную библиотеку от корки до корки. Потом зубришь, именно, сука, вызубриваешь конвенцию по написанию питоньего кода - PEP8, чтобы от зубов отскакивало. Когда напишешь свою первую имиджборду, по пути изучив верстку на html+css, скачиваешь и изучаешь любой питоний асинхронный вебсервер, рекомендую Tornado или Gevent. Как переделаешь имиджборду, чтобы выдавала по крайней мере 5 тысяч запросов в секунду, можешь идти дальше - тебя ждет увлекательный мир хайлоада. Apache Hadoop, сверхбыстрые асинхронные key-value хранилища, MapReduce. Отсос хиккующих выблядков / просто неудачников типа рейфага или сисярп/джава-хуесосов, которые сосут хуй по жизни не заставит себя ждать и уже через пол года ты будешь получать такие суммы, что любая баба будет течь при одном упоминании твоей зарплаты.
Как вы в програмизды вкатываетесь? Пытался учить js - вроде разбираюсь, но это настолько скучно что сил что-то по желанию делать просто нет. Никакой магии, одно нелогичное задроство.
>>167599295 Да, я про российский. В основном всякие битриксы, вордпрессы и всякая подобная чушь. Читаю такие треды, и не понимаю, где вы работу с такими технологиями находите. Никто не готов платить за разработку с нуля.
>>167599366 >российский ну понятно. на галерах используют то что позволяет получить какой-нибудь результат с минимальными затратами - пхп, вордпресс и битрикс. попробуй устроится в нормальную фирму.
ну а вообще твой путь в этом случае - ынтырпрайз, т.е. жабка/с#. будешь свои 100к получать, жить и не тужить.
>>167604891 Да ну, я не поверю, что для ноды нет фреймворков, которые натягиваешь поверх экспресса, подключаешь к базе и имеешь готовый интернет магазин с какой-никакой ЦМСкой как это есть в джанге
>>167605120 Так-то да, но два продукта от одной компании должны уж как-то уживаться
>>167594898 (OP) Как вкатиться? Выперли из вуза, есть месяц на обучение. С 8 до 8 могу учить Хотя говорят что больше 6 часов чистой нагрузки на мозг - нереально.
Задавайте свои ответы про веб разработку. На джумле, вордпресс и прочем не работаю. Отбитые дауны, которые считают, что веб - это лэндинги и интернет магазины идут нахуй